Kerry Lange Posted January 19, 2004 Share Posted January 19, 2004 I have the factory Delco AM/FM/CB radio in my '81 Regency that functioned well until recently. Now the FM functions on mono only, instead of stereo. I can temporarily correct this by quickly turning the radio off and on, or by turning the selector from FM to AM and back again. This only lasts for a few seconds to several minutes before the stereo light goes out and the radio returns to Mono. Do I need a rebuild, or is this something i can handle myself?
